Virtual Evacuation Exercise Recording and Presentation
Hello neighbors, On Tuesday, February 1st, we successfully held our first Virtual Evacuation Exercise that included a train derailment and Chlorine Gas Leak. This simulated incident impacted areas all over Northwest Eugene. Thank you to David Monk and John Quetzalcoatl Murray for facilitating our event! … Continue reading
